
ZESCO Ndola Girls concluded their group stage campaign in the TotalEnergies CAF Women’s Champions League | COSAFA Qualifiers with a dramatic 5-3 victory over Malawian side Ntopwa FC.
The Zambian champions looked to be cruising after storming to a 5-0 lead, but a late surge from Ntopwa turned the game into a tense, edge-of-the-seat spectacle.
⚡ First Half: ZESCO Show Dominance
It took just eight minutes for skipper Avell Chitundu to break the deadlock, finishing smartly from close range after a perfectly weighted pass from Judith Soko.
ZESCO continued to press and thought they had doubled the lead when Penelope Mulubwa found the net, only for her effort to be ruled out for offside. The pressure, however, eventually paid off as Eneless Phiri struck just before halftime to give the Zegalicious Girls a comfortable 2-0 lead.
🔥 Second Half: Goals Galore
The second half started the same way the first ended—ZESCO on the front foot. Substitute Charity Mubanga made it 3-0 with a close-range finish just three minutes after the restart.
At the 64th minute mark, Mila Malambo scored a stunner, marking her first-ever goal for ZESCO. Soon after, Phiri returned to the spotlight, dribbling past four defenders before unleashing a ferocious strike to extend the lead to 5-0.
At that point, it looked like ZESCO were on course for a routine victory. But football, as always, had other plans.
💥 Ntopwa’s Late Fightback
With just under 10 minutes to play, Rose Alufandika pulled one back for Ntopwa with a well-placed header from a corner.
Two minutes later, Kondawo Banda unleashed a thunderbolt past goalkeeper Hazel Nali, reducing the deficit to 5-2.
The drama continued deep into stoppage time when Jessie Yosefe broke free and calmly slotted past Nali to make it 5-3.
Despite the scare, ZESCO held on for a vital win that keeps their qualification hopes alive.
🌟 Player of the Match
Eneless Phiri was deservedly named Player of the Match after scoring twice and orchestrating most of ZESCO’s attacking play.

✅ Full-Time Score
ZESCO Ndola Girls 5–3 Ntopwa FC
⚽ Chitundu (8’), Phiri (44’, 78’), Mubanga (48’), Malambo (64’) | Alufandika (81’), Banda (90’), Yosefe (90+5’)
